Amendment Since initial award the Potential Award value has increased 1208% from $21,023 to $274,908.
Recompete The following similar solicitation(s) may continue aspects of this contract: Explosive Detection Canine Team (EDCT) Services in Manhattan, NYC, NY and Bethesda, MD, Explosive Detection Canine Team (EDCT) Services in Manhattan, NY, NYC & DC Explosive Detection Canine Team (EDCT) Services
Subcontracting Plan This Delivery Order has an Individual Subcontract Plan. The Department of Homeland Security has an overall small business subcontracting goal of 43%
Michael Stapleton Associates was awarded Delivery Order 70RFP123FRE200022 (70RFP1-23-F-RE200022) for Explosive Detection Canine Team (EDCT) Services, Manhattan, Nyc, Ny worth up to $274,908 by Federal Protective Service in October 2019. The contract has a duration of 5 years 5 months and was awarded full & open with NAICS 561612 and PSC S206 via simplified acquisition acquisition procedures.
